What Superbowl fan wouldn’t love settling into the game with one of these hefty handfuls? Lois McAtee in Oceanside, California says they taste special but couldn’t be easier to make…unless you microwave them, which she often does!

Nutritional Facts 1 sandwich (prepared with reduced-fat sour cream, reduced-sodium soup mix and reduced-fat cheese) equals 339 calories, 7 g fat (3 g saturated fat), 43 mg cholesterol, 1,320 mg sodium, 39 g carbohydrate, 2 g fiber, 28 g protein.
